Chief Minister Bhupesh Baghel on Saturday added two more days to the celebrations of Rajyotsav-2019 making it a five-day event in place of earlier announced three-days, to complement the wish of Governor Anusuiya Uikey. Rajyotsav-2019 was to be celebrated from November 1 to 3, but now it has been extended till November 5. Addressing the gathering on the second day of the Rajyotsav on Saturday, chief guest Governor Anusuiya Uikey said, “I am delighted to see the response of public at the various stalls here and I would like to compare it with Delhi Trade Fair.
 
I wish Chief Minister Baghel, considering public response, would extend the Rajyotsav for one more week.” Respecting the wish of the Governor, Baghel said, “The wish of Governor is an order for us and therefore I add two more days to the celebrations.” Earlier, Governor recalled the unforgettable contribution of former Prime Minister Atal Behari Vajpayee towards the formation of Chhattisgarh, day after Chief Minister Baghel ignored Vajpayee during his inaugural address on the first day of Rajyotsav on November 1. Meanwhile, the Governor also remembered the great personalities of Chhattisgarh who fought for the separate state.
 
The Governor also contradicted Chief Minister Baghel that development of Chhattisgarh had come to a grinding halt in last 15 years and said that the state progressed in all sectors ever since it was made a separate state. The Governor hailed Chhattisgarh Government’s new Industry Policy 2019-24. Chief Minister Baghel has taken a good initiative for the development of backward areas of state. The new industry policy would prove to be a boon for the state, the Governor asserted.
 
In his presiding address, Chief Minister Baghel said the life of people has become easy under present government. Bastar and Surguja divisions, which has been confronting with numerous problems, have overcome those problems due to proactive and swift action by the present government, said Baghel. State Culture Minister Amarjeet Bhagat delivered the welcome address. Mismanagement rules the roost Mismanagement visible as crowd started rushing to the Rajyotsav venue on Saturday evening. The narrow road to the Pt Ravishankar Shukla University, which was being used for both entry and exit, caused a lot of hardship for the visitors who were seen shouting at the police and traffic personnel demanding a separate exit for them.
